Scientist Makes Chilling Prediction On The Exact Date Of The End Of The World
A scientist made a prediction about the exact date the world will end, and it’s just around the corner.
Doomsday predictions have existed for as long as human beings have been capable of imagining their own extinction.
From ancient prophecies to medieval plague theology to Cold War nuclear anxiety, every era has produced its own vision of how it all ends.
Most have come and gone without incident, footnotes in the long history of human catastrophising.
But a prediction made by a respected physicist in 1960, arrived at not through mysticism or conspiracy, but through rigorous mathematical modelling, has resurfaced on social media with renewed urgency.
Because the date it names is not centuries away, it’s just weeks from now.
The man behind the maths
Heinz von Foerster was not a crank or a doomsayer. Born in Vienna in 1911, he was a serious and highly regarded scientist whose work spanned cybernetics, cognitive science, and systems theory, per the Mirror.
He helped found the Biological Computer Laboratory at the University of Illinois and contributed to fields as diverse as artificial intelligence and philosophy of mind. He is not the kind of figure whose work is easily dismissed.
In 1960, von Foerster and his colleagues published a paper in the prestigious journal Science in which they presented a mathematical analysis of human population growth.
Working from historical data, they modelled the trajectory of global population and identified what they described as a critical threshold, a point at which unchecked exponential growth would push humanity toward a mathematical singularity.
The paper described this as the point at which population growth, if it continued along its historical trajectory, would theoretically reach infinity, or, as they more practically described it, the point at which humanity would ‘squeeze itself to death’ through sheer numerical pressure on the planet’s finite resources.
What the theory actually claims
It is important to be precise about what von Foerster’s model predicted, and what it did not.
The paper was not claiming that every human being on Earth would die simultaneously on a specific date.
It was not a prophecy in any mystical sense. What the mathematical model showed was that if population growth continued at the exponential rates observed between the 1600s and 1960, the growth curve would reach a vertical asymptote (a mathematical point of infinity) around that date.
In practical terms, this represented a ‘doomsday’ not through a single catastrophic event but through the inevitable collapse that would follow from a population growing faster than the planet’s carrying capacity could sustain.
The mechanisms of that collapse, as von Foerster and his colleagues described them, would include environmental breakdown as natural systems buckled under the pressure of billions of people demanding resources from them, resource exhaustion as food, water, and energy supplies became insufficient to meet demand, and societal conflict as competition for diminishing resources created the conditions for war, famine, and systemic breakdown.
The Friday the 13th date is, von Foerster himself acknowledged, a piece of dark humour embedded in an otherwise serious calculation, a wry acknowledgement that the numbers, when he ran them, produced a result that seemed almost designed to unsettle.

So should we be worried?
The honest answer, according to modern demographers and population scientists, is: not about the specific date, but perhaps about the broader warning the model contains.
The most immediate counterargument is simply empirical. Global population in 1960, when von Foerster published his paper, stood at approximately 3.02 billion. Today, it stands at around 8.3 billion, a significant increase, but a very long way from infinity.
More importantly, the trajectory of population growth has changed substantially since 1960.
Global birth rates have fallen dramatically, driven by improved access to education, particularly for women and girls, better family planning resources, and the well-documented demographic transition that tends to accompany economic development.
The United Nations projects that global population will peak somewhere between 9.5 and 10 billion people later this century before beginning to level off or decline.
In other words, the exponential growth curve that von Foerster was modelling has not continued in the way his 1960 data suggested it would.
The specific catastrophe his mathematics described, a human population growing without limit until the system simply breaks, has not materialised in the form he predicted.
But to dismiss the prediction entirely on those grounds would be to miss what it was actually saying.
Von Foerster’s work was less a literal forecast and more a warning: a demonstration of where unchecked growth leads when you follow the mathematics to its conclusion.
The point was not ‘this will definitely happen on this date’ but rather ‘this is what happens if the trends we are observing continue without intervention.’
The fact that they did not continue without intervention, that birth rates fell, that family planning expanded, that education reduced fertility, could be read not as evidence that von Foerster was wrong, but as evidence that the warning was, in some sense, heard.
A second doomsday theory
Von Foerster’s is not the only mathematically grounded doomsday argument to have attracted serious attention.
In 1983, astrophysicist Brandon Carter, one of the scientists who contributed to the development of the anthropic principle in cosmology, published what has become known as the Carter Catastrophe, or the Doomsday Argument, per VT.
Carter’s reasoning was different from von Foerster’s and in some ways more philosophically unsettling. His argument begins from a statistical premise: if you were to draw yourself at random from the total set of all human beings who will ever live, what would you expect to find about when in human history you exist?
The argument proceeds from there to suggest that any given person alive today should update their expectations about the future of humanity based on the simple fact of their own existence.
Because the total number of humans who will ever live is, in principle, fixed by the eventual end of the human species, a randomly selected human being is more likely to exist somewhere in the middle of that total count than at the very beginning or end of it.
The uncomfortable implication is that the total number of humans who will ever exist may not be vastly larger than the number who have already existed, meaning that the end of the human story may be closer in time than an optimistic view of the future would suggest.
Carter’s argument is a matter of ongoing debate in philosophy and cosmology. Critics point to multiple assumptions embedded in its logic that may not hold. Supporters argue that it represents a genuine and underappreciated probabilistic insight about the likely duration of human civilisation.
Neither argument should be a cause for immediate panic. November 13, 2026, will almost certainly pass without incident.
But as a prompt for thinking seriously about population, resource management, climate change, and the long-term sustainability of human civilisation, the work of both von Foerster and Carter remains as relevant as the day it was published.
